About Monteith, Ontario

Monteith is a compact rural community in Cochrane, Ontario,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Monteith is located at 48.6443°N, 80.6812°W.

Monteith rests on the undulating terrain of Northern Ontario, a landscape carved by ancient glaciers and softened by centuries of boreal forest. It lies 19.9 km north-west of Matheson, ON (from Matheson, ON: bearing 307°T), and is situated 12.9 km north-west of Watabeag. The story of Monteith is deeply entwined with the agricultural promise and the hardy spirit of its settlers. This was a place envisioned as a hub for farming and industry, its fertile pockets of land offering a chance to cultivate a life far from the crowded south. While the dream of large-scale agriculture has evolved, the land continues to yield, supporting dairy farms and the cultivation of crops suited to the northern climate, a testament to enduring resilience. The presence of the Monteith Correctional Centre, a landmark for many, also shapes the local rhythm, a quiet reminder of the broader systems that touch even these remote corners.
